Akamai DNS Outage: Downtime At PS, Amazon, UPS, Steam, Airbnb, HBO Max, COD, PayTM

PayTM, PSN, UPS, and a lot of apps and websites are down.

Major websites and platforms like the PlayStation Network, Steam, Airbnb, and FedEx are reportedly down. Over 50,000 reports and counting are reported on Downdetector.

Apart from gaming platforms like Steam and the PlayStation Network, travel websites like Airbnb and Expedia are also down. Popular games like Genshin Impact and Call of Duty and e-packet services like FedEx and UPS are also reportedly down.

When Will The Websites Be Back?

The issue has been identified, and it’s due to the outage of Edge DNS in Akamai servers and partially due to Amazon Web Services.

The list of apps that are currently having issues also has some popular streaming sites like Hulu, HBO Max, and Zee5. Apart from that, e-payment platforms like PayTM, Amazon Pay, and Discover are also down.

Many websites and apps have recovered from the outage; hence, expect things to get back to normal pretty soon.
